当前位置: 技术问答>linux和unix
linux内核模块编译好后,用insmod XX.ko文件,老是报错
来源: 互联网 发布时间:2017-05-22
本文导语: 每次用insmod xx.ko文件,就显示下面的内容,请问该怎么做? insmod: error inserting 'hello.ko': -1 Invalid module format | 是不是 编译内核时: [ ]Enable loadable module support ----> [ ]Forced module...
每次用insmod xx.ko文件,就显示下面的内容,请问该怎么做?
insmod: error inserting 'hello.ko': -1 Invalid module format
insmod: error inserting 'hello.ko': -1 Invalid module format
|
是不是 编译内核时:
[ ]Enable loadable module support ---->
[ ]Forced module loading
....
相关选项没选呢?
也有可能是其他的 ...
容我再看看
[ ]Enable loadable module support ---->
[ ]Forced module loading
....
相关选项没选呢?
也有可能是其他的 ...
容我再看看
|
你插入的哪个内核 和 编译模块用的内核源码 要一致
|
dmesg 查看内核的错误信息
当然这个是初学者常见问题之一,lz很可能使用的ubuntu,
你编译ko使用的linux内核版本跟你当前正在运行的内核版本不一致
当然这个是初学者常见问题之一,lz很可能使用的ubuntu,
你编译ko使用的linux内核版本跟你当前正在运行的内核版本不一致
|
insmod xx
or
modprobe xx
or
modprobe xx
您可能感兴趣的文章:
本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。
本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。